Why Reactive Technology Management is a Losing Game

Relying on a reactive approach to technology management – waiting for something to break before fixing it – is akin to ignoring preventative healthcare. It leads to several detrimental outcomes:

  • Increased Downtime: When systems fail unexpectedly, the resulting downtime can cripple operations. A 2025 study by the Uptime Institute found that the average cost of downtime per incident is $9,000 per minute, and that figure continues to rise.
  • Higher Costs: Reactive fixes are often more expensive than preventative measures. Emergency repairs, expedited shipping of replacement parts, and overtime pay for IT staff all contribute to higher costs.
  • Reduced Productivity: Downtime and system failures disrupt workflows, leading to decreased productivity and missed deadlines. Employees spend valuable time troubleshooting issues instead of focusing on their core responsibilities.
  • Security Vulnerabilities: Patches and updates released to address security vulnerabilities are often ignored in reactive environments. This leaves systems exposed to cyber threats and data breaches.
  • Damaged Reputation: Frequent system failures and data breaches can erode customer trust and damage a company’s reputation. In today’s hyper-connected world, negative experiences spread quickly.

The reactive approach also creates a stressful and chaotic work environment. IT teams are constantly putting out fires, which leads to burnout and decreased morale. Cultivating a Solution-Oriented Mindset in Technology

Becoming and solution-oriented. requires a fundamental shift in mindset. It involves anticipating potential problems, identifying their root causes, and developing proactive solutions. Here are some key strategies:

  1. Implement Proactive Monitoring: Use monitoring tools like Datadog or Dynatrace to track system performance, identify anomalies, and detect potential problems before they escalate. Configure alerts to notify IT staff when critical thresholds are exceeded.
  2. Conduct Regular Security Audits: Perform regular security audits to identify vulnerabilities in your systems and networks. Use penetration testing tools to simulate attacks and assess your organization’s security posture.
  3. Implement a Patch Management System: Ensure that all software and operating systems are regularly patched and updated to address security vulnerabilities and improve performance. Automate the patching process to minimize downtime and reduce the risk of human error.
  4. Develop a Disaster Recovery Plan: Create a comprehensive disaster recovery plan that outlines the steps to be taken in the event of a major system failure or data breach. Test the plan regularly to ensure that it is effective.
  5. Invest in Training: Provide ongoing training to IT staff to ensure that they have the skills and knowledge necessary to proactively manage technology. This includes training on new technologies, security best practices, and troubleshooting techniques.
  6. Foster a Culture of Continuous Improvement: Encourage IT staff to identify areas for improvement and to develop innovative solutions to technology challenges. Implement a feedback mechanism to capture ideas and suggestions from employees.

Leveraging Technology for Proactive Problem Solving

Technology itself can be a powerful tool for proactive problem solving. Here are some examples:

  • Artificial Intelligence (AI): AI-powered analytics can be used to identify patterns and anomalies in data, predict potential problems, and automate preventative maintenance. For example, AI can analyze sensor data from industrial equipment to predict when maintenance is required, reducing downtime and extending the life of the equipment.
  • Machine Learning (ML): ML algorithms can be trained to identify and classify security threats, automate incident response, and improve the accuracy of threat detection systems.
  • Cloud Computing: Cloud-based infrastructure provides greater scalability, resilience, and redundancy than traditional on-premise systems. This reduces the risk of downtime and makes it easier to recover from disasters.
  • Automation: Automation tools can be used to automate routine tasks, such as patching, backups, and system monitoring. This frees up IT staff to focus on more strategic initiatives.
  • Predictive Analytics: By analyzing historical data, predictive analytics can forecast future trends and identify potential problems before they occur. For example, predictive analytics can be used to forecast demand for IT resources and proactively scale infrastructure to meet anticipated needs.

By strategically implementing these technologies, organizations can significantly improve their ability to proactively manage technology and avoid costly problems.

The Financial Benefits of a Proactive Technology Strategy

While the initial investment in proactive technology management may seem significant, the long-term financial benefits far outweigh the costs. These benefits include:

  • Reduced Downtime Costs: By preventing system failures and minimizing downtime, organizations can save significant amounts of money. As mentioned earlier, the average cost of downtime per incident is substantial.
  • Lower Maintenance Costs: Proactive maintenance reduces the need for costly emergency repairs and extends the life of equipment.
  • Increased Productivity: By minimizing disruptions and improving system performance, organizations can increase employee productivity.
  • Improved Security: Proactive security measures reduce the risk of data breaches and cyberattacks, which can result in significant financial losses. IBM’s 2025 Cost of a Data Breach Report estimates the average cost of a data breach at $4.6 million.
  • Enhanced Customer Satisfaction: Reliable systems and secure data handling lead to increased customer trust and satisfaction, which can translate into higher sales and revenue.

A proactive approach to technology management is not just about avoiding problems; it’s about creating a more efficient, productive, and profitable organization. Building a Solution-Oriented Team for Technology

Adopting a and solution-oriented. approach to technology isn’t solely about implementing new software or hardware. It requires building a team equipped with the right skills, mindset, and culture. Here’s how:

  • Hire Problem Solvers: During the hiring process, assess candidates’ problem-solving skills through scenario-based questions and technical challenges. Look for individuals who demonstrate a proactive and analytical approach.
  • Encourage Collaboration: Foster a collaborative environment where team members can freely share ideas, insights, and solutions. Break down silos between departments to promote cross-functional problem solving. Asana can be an effective tool for managing collaborative projects.
  • Provide Training and Development: Invest in ongoing training and development programs to equip your team with the latest technical skills and problem-solving techniques. Offer opportunities for certifications and professional development.
  • Empower Decision-Making: Empower team members to make decisions and take ownership of their work. Encourage them to experiment with new technologies and approaches.
  • Celebrate Successes: Recognize and reward team members for their contributions to proactive problem solving. Celebrate successes and share lessons learned.

By building a solution-oriented team, organizations can create a culture of continuous improvement and innovation, enabling them to stay ahead of the curve in the ever-evolving world of technology.

What is the first step in becoming solution-oriented in technology?

The first step is recognizing the limitations of a reactive approach and actively seeking opportunities to anticipate and prevent problems. This involves shifting your mindset from firefighting to proactive planning.

How can AI help with proactive technology management?

AI can analyze large datasets to identify patterns and anomalies, predict potential problems, and automate preventative maintenance. This allows organizations to address issues before they escalate and minimize downtime.

What are some key skills for a solution-oriented technology team?

Key skills include analytical thinking, problem-solving, communication, collaboration, and a willingness to learn and adapt to new technologies.

How often should security audits be performed?

Security audits should be performed regularly, ideally at least once a year, or more frequently if there are significant changes to your systems or networks.

What is the role of leadership in fostering a solution-oriented technology culture?

Leadership plays a crucial role in setting the tone, providing resources, and empowering teams to be proactive and innovative. They should encourage experimentation, celebrate successes, and create a safe space for learning from failures.
